What's New:
A new transient detection — to slice them all
Based on a state-of-the-art algorithm, Cubase 6 introduces a
straightforward and intelligent transient detection function. Finding all drum
hits is a breeze now, thanks to the intuitive preview feature and two
specialized filters, called Peak and Beats. With this powerful tool on hand, you
can detect single hits, rolls and ghost notes faster and more accurate than ever
before. After the transients have been
detected they are merged across multiple tracks by taking user definable
priority of individual tracks into account. The drumhits are then cut up and
grouped together ready for detailed tweaking. In this way, copying that great
fill from verse 2 to verse 1 is solved with minimum effort: select one, move
them all.
Advanced tempo detection
Cubase 6 features a newly developed tempo detection algorithm, which
accurately and semi-automatically determines the tempo of any rhythmic audio
material. This makes it easy to determine the tempo of a drum performance that
has not been recorded to a metronome. The resulting tempo map can be used for to
keep the dynamic feeling of natural tempo variations or to remove unwanted tempo
changes quickly. Whatever rhythm is at hand, Cubase 6 will detect the tempo and
match the track to a beat grid of your choice.
Multitrack audio quantization
In Cubase 6 rhythmic audio material can be quantized just like any MIDI
material, offering numerous possibilities to fix timing issues and to change the
groove of live-recorded drums. To preserve phase relationships between tracks,
the individual slices on all tracks are still grouped and moved at once. Cubase
automatically creates cross-fades between slices to ensure seamless transitions
between them and fill gaps that might be introduced during quantization. A few
clicks, and all drum tracks are matched to the bass drum, snare or whatever
source or sources are desired. With the Slice Rules you can decide which sources
will get a higher priority during slicing.
Straightforward drum replacement
The bass drum needs some extra punch? The snare drum doesn’t cut
through the mix? With the new Hitpoint-to-MIDI function, it gets very easy to
replace, double or enrich live-recorded drum sounds. When the transients have
been detected, a single click on the Create MIDI Notes button creates a MIDI
track containing a MIDI note for each single drum hit. From here, it’s up to you
which sampler or synth you want to fuel with the note. A good choice would be
the powerful Groove Agent ONE drum sampler, included in Cubase 6.
ONJURE THE PERFECT TAKE
Cubase 6 comes with a new Lane Track concept for lightning fast
multitake comping. When recording several takes, Cubase instantly creates a Lane
Track for each take. From here, it’s just a short way to perfection: Simply
swipe across the best parts of a take and Cubase automatically creates a master
take that contains all selected parts. For comfortable comping, each Lane Track
sports a solo button and full editing functionality — building the perfect take
has never been that easy.
BRING TOGETHER WHAT BELONGS TOGETHER
The new Track Edit Groups tool refines the work with multitrack
recordings in Cubase. This new function allows multitrack editing with
single-click actions. Whether it is guitar, bass or ambient recording,
professional sound engineers mix several signals to get the best results. When
recording a guitar for example, it is common to record signals from different
amps or microphone types on separate tracks. With Track Edit Groups activated,
related tracks are tied together and can be edited at once, making this new
feature a huge time-saver.

MINIMUM SYSTEM REQUIREMENTS
The minimum system requirements state the minimal specification your computer must have to be able to use the software.
Mac OS
Mac OS X Version 10.6*
Intel dual core CPU
2 GB RAM
Display resolution of 1280 x 800 recommended
CoreAudio compatible audio hardware
8 GB of free HD space
DVD-ROM dual-layer drive
USB port for USB-eLicenser (license management)
Internet connection for license activation
* Native 32-bit and 64-bit Cubase version included.
Windows
Windows 7*
Intel or AMD dual core CPU
2 GB RAM
Display resolution of 1280 x 800 recommended
Windows compatible audio hardware (ASIO compatible audio hardware recommended
for low-latency performance)
8 GB of free HD space
DVD-ROM dual-layer drive
USB port for USB-eLicenser (license management)
Internet connection for license activation
* Native 32-bit and 64-bit Cubase version included.
